    Can I get the burrito lettuce wrapped?

    Hi Angel, I'd recommend trying our Fiesta Bowl. It has very similar ingredients to the burrito but served on lettuce.

    What is the fake meat made of?

    Seitan, Soybean, Jackfruit, etc.... it varies for each dish and/or meal. I know some items are gluten free which would be wheat free... the soy chorizo, carnitas and beef for starters.
